Coffee table, designed by Severin Hansen Jr. for Haslev Møbelfabrik in the 1960s. Renowned for his razor-sharp minimalist silhouettes, Hansen’s work beautifully balances organic wood tones with striking, industrial material accents.
It features Hansen’s absolute signature design hallmark: seamlessly executed, sharp three-way mitered corner joints that flow flawlessly down into elegant, tapered legs. This structural mastery gives the table a light, floating appearance.
Set into the heart of the teak frame is a spectacular, textured copper inlay top. This metallic surface introduces an incredible depth of character to the piece, featuring a rich, dark patina with shifting fiery orange, bronze, and metallic undertones that catch the light beautifully from every angle.
This piece is in excellent vintage condition including the"Danish Control" stamp on the underside of the table.
